130. Deputy James Browne asked the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form the position regarding OPW approval for a person (details supplied); and if he will make a statement on the matter. [52071/19]
View answerI am advised by the Commissioners of Public Works that the former married quarters adjoining the Garda station in Carrick-On-Bannow, Co. Wexford was sold to a private individual in 1991.
The owner is currently selling the property. During this process, a mapping discrepancy was identified between that property (former married quarters) and the Garda station property. This discrepancy needs to be rectified by way of a Deed of Rectification in order for the sale to proceed.
This matter is being progressed by the Office of Public Works, the Chief State Solicitor's Office and solicitors acting for the owner .
